Transaction 6182462478c08045c9e199fe02aed067cd98ecc6fadfa62413907a370fe307ca

7 Input
2 Outputs
  • 6182462478c08045c9e199fe02aed067cd98ecc6fadfa62413907a370fe307ca:0
  • value  800000000
    address  3CMqGSHmbEpTuDeeWRByVrQtWJzE1FKnKU
  • 6182462478c08045c9e199fe02aed067cd98ecc6fadfa62413907a370fe307ca:1
  • value  87000822
    address  bc1qr4ryz5umtc7jhsamljnpk3x8z6qvtretg7mfx3